What the bond and insurance requirements mean for homeowners

Registration as a specialty contractor in Washington requires a $15,000 surety bond on file with the Department of Labor & Industries; the general contractor requirement is $30,000.

The bond is a limited fund a homeowner (or subcontractor or supplier) can make a claim against, through the courts, if a registered contractor fails to meet its obligations on a job. Contractors must also keep general liability insurance on file — at least $50,000 in property damage and $200,000 in public liability coverage, or a $250,000 combined single limit — which covers damage the contractor causes, not workmanship disputes. What is a Doors, Gates and Activating Devices contractor licensed to do in Washington?

Door and gate contractors install and service doors, gates, and the operators and activating devices that automate them. Typical jobs include commercial door installation, gate operator repair, and access-control integration on driveways and entries. A $15,000 surety bond and general liability insurance, filed with WA L&I, are required for this registration.
